.m-event-listing h2{margin-bottom:2.2rem}.m-event-listing__filter{align-items:center;display:inline-flex;margin-bottom:2.5rem}.m-event-listing__filter .event-filter__title{margin-bottom:0;margin-right:1.65rem}.m-event-listing__filter .event-filter__select{margin-right:1.6rem}.m-event-listing__filter .event-filter__select:last-of-type{margin-right:0}.m-event-listing__filter .event-filter__select-option{align-items:center;display:flex}.m-event-listing__filter .event-filter__select-option::before{background-position:center;background-size:90%;background-repeat:no-repeat;border:.05rem solid #c2c5cc;border-radius:.2rem;content:'';flex:0 0 16px;height:16px;margin-right:.5rem;width:16px}.m-event-listing__filter .event-filter__select-option:not(.active)::before{background:#fff}.m-event-listing__filter .event-filter__select-option:hover{cursor:pointer}.m-event-listing .filter__result{margin-bottom:2.5rem}.event-card{align-items:flex-start;background-color:#fff;border:.05rem solid #e6e8ec;border-radius:0 0 .25rem .25rem;box-shadow:0 .3rem .5rem rgba(15,59,45,0.03);display:flex;flex-direction:column;height:100%;justify-content:space-between;padding:12.26% 9.17% 10.475% 10.475%}.event-card__type{font-size:.9rem;line-height:1.56;margin-bottom:.3rem}.event-card__title{margin-bottom:.6rem}.event-card__date{border-bottom:.05rem solid #efefef;margin-bottom:1.4rem;padding-bottom:1.1rem}.event-card__description{margin-bottom:2.9rem!important}.event-card__buttons{align-items:center;display:flex}.event-card__cta{background-color:#fff;border:.05rem solid #e6e8ec;border-radius:.25rem;box-shadow:0 .3rem .5rem rgba(15,59,45,0.03);font-size:.9rem;margin-right:1.1rem;overflow:unset;padding:.825rem 1.4rem;position:unset;transition:background .1s linear,border .1s linear,color .1s linear}.event-card__cta:hover{background-color:#f5f5ff;border-color:#d5dae2}